Hi -- I tried searching the forums but didn't see this question.

Is it possible to add fields to the customer registration form? If this is not built-in, would this be possible via a custom plugin/widget?

Thanks.
12 years ago
You can enable/disable some built-in form fields (admin area > configuration > settings > customer settings)

jyjohnson wrote:
You can enable/disable some built-in form fields (admin area > configuration > settings > customer settings)

Yes, I saw that. But is it possible to add your own (custom) profile fields?

Thanks.


Yes this can be done by adding new fields in Custom customer attributes in Customer Setting page.
